Immigrating to Canada: A Comprehensive Guide

The process of immigrating to Canada offers a variety of options based on individual needs and goals. Whether you're eyeing permanent residency or ming for Canadian citizenship, understanding the distinct pathways will be your first step towards making this dream a reality.

Steps Towards Permanent Residency

  1. Understanding Eligibility: Before applying for any form of entry into Canada, it's crucial to understand what makes one eligible based on factors like education background, work experience, skills, or family ties within Canada.

  2. Choosing the Right Pathway:

    • Express Entry Programs: Ideal for skilled workers who are proficient in English or French and meet other eligibility criteria such as age, education, and work experience.

    • Provincial Nominee Program PNP: Offers a pathway to permanent residency through partnerships between provinces and the federal government. Each province has its own unique requirements based on their specific needs.

    • Family Class: For those who wish to bring family members to Canada, the Family Sponsorship category might be suitable.

  3. Gathering Documentation: Preparing necessary documents such as your educational transcripts, work certificates, language proficiency test results like IELTS or TOEFL, and proof of financial solvency is crucial for a smooth application process.

  4. Completing the Application: Submitting the correct forms through the Canadian government's online portal requires attention to detl and adherence to guidelines.

Pathway to Citizenship

Applying for citizenship after gning permanent residency involves an interview process conducted by Immigration, Refugees, and Citizenship Canada IRCC officers. The process includes:

  1. Understanding Requirements: You must have been a legal permanent resident of Canada for at least three years before applying for citizenship.

  2. Language Proficiency: Demonstrating knowledge of English or French through list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ills is mandatory.

  3. Integration into Canadian Society: Showing your understanding of Canadian history, government, values, and rights ensures you are prepared to integrate fully into society.
